Materials
They can be manufactured from a single material, such as carbon steel, stainless steel (AISI-304L, AISI-316L), duplex, or super duplex. Alternatively, they can be made from a combination of materials , for example, a carbon steel frame with the other components in stainless steel.
Dimensions
The following data are required for calculating the dimensions of an automatic cable grate:
- Width and height of the canal
- Maximum water level from the base of the canal.
- Pitch.
- Waste type.
- Discharge height measured above the manoeuvring floor.Discharge height measured above the manoeuvring floor.
- Lifting load.
Technical data
Drive unit
It consists of a main steel transmission shaft mounted on bearings. This shaft includes a hollow axle geared motor and drums for winding the transmission cables. The cables are guided by pulleys that support the bucket-comb assembly.
Frame
A welded structure made from steel or stainless steel profiles, equipped with anchors for securing to civil works. The frame is designed and calculated to support both lifting loads and 100% of the hydraulic thrust.
Grate
The set of bars is arranged with spacing according to requirements. The grate is designed and calculated to withstand 100% of the hydraulic thrust. The angle of inclination is typically 85 degrees relative to the slab, although it can be designed for other angles. The bars generally have a rectangular geometry.
Cleaning system
The grate features an oscillating bucket with combs that are inserted between the bars for cleaning. A main geared motor drives the bucket for raising and lowering, while an additional motor handles the opening and closing. On the upper frame, the grate includes an oscillating scraper with a plastic end to clean the comb bucket during the final phase of the ascent manoeuvre.
